So, it's time to start seriously talking about migrating all the 'original' users to an email-based username. For the ones that currently have an email address I suspect we'll send them an email and either ask them to change, or tell them that it's happening at some point. However, there are a set of users who have no email address. What is the scope of that? Presumably, if they don't have a syncNode, we don't care and can just migrate them, so it's just the combo of syncNode and no email that's an issue.
